    The Upcoming BMW M5 Officially Has 592 HP And xDrive

    By Zero2TurboMay 17, 2017No Comments
    Facebook Email Twitter LinkedIn Telegram WhatsApp
    Share
    Facebook Email Twitter LinkedIn WhatsApp Telegram

    So we finally have some official information from the manufacturer itself regarding their highly anticipated super saloon, the new M5. Is is being described as the “most exciting and emotionally enthralling high-performance sedan” ever created by BMW M but what can we expect when it does actually arrive?

    • 4.4-litre TwinPower Turbo V8 producing 600 PS (592 hp) and over 700 Nm of torque
    • 8-speed M Steptronic transmission
    • 0 to 100km/h in less than 3.5 seconds (will it match or beat the E63 S?)
    • M xDrive all-wheel drive system
    • It will remain RWD most of the time as traction is only sent to the front wheels when needed
    • The AWD system will have three different modes including: 2WD, 4WD, and 4WD Sport
    • 2WD setting deactivates the all-wheel drive system and turns the model into drifting machine
    • New active M Differential
    • Interior follows in the footsteps of the standard model but the M5 has been equipped with a new shifter and an M sports steering wheel with two individually configurable M Drive buttons.
    • You will also get an improved Head-Up Display with new graphics, navigation functionality, and a 70% larger viewing area.
